IP查询
查询
你查询的IP:[114.80.188.24] 地理位置:中国–上海–上海电信/IDC机房
最新查询
121.51.47.243
222.192.31.111
116.112.55.91
218.96.99.96
120.52.78.92
117.64.84.126
60.128.83.152
116.199.217.96
222.192.138.234
114.80.188.24
119.63.32.210
218.56.174.246
123.96.29.251
202.143.16.225
202.127.208.255
203.175.128.249
124.108.8.78
116.2.201.239
202.91.176.60
121.255.100.117
125.171.187.224
211.160.110.5
221.130.215.89
202.152.176.179
119.63.32.30
60.255.6.239
123.52.28.155
202.170.128.133
202.127.224.186
203.80.144.1
202.38.140.185